Technical specifications

What’s in the box

• Nexus 6 phone

• USB sync/charge cable

• AC Adapter and cable

• Quick start guide

• Safety and warranty information

• Wired headset (FR, IN only)

Learn more at google.com/nexus

• Size: 82.98 mm x 159.26 mm x 10.06 mm

• Weight: 185g

• Color: Midnight Blue

• Software: Android 5.0, Lollipop

• Screen: 5.96” QHD AMOLED display 16:9 aspect ratio, 2560x1440, 493 ppi Gorilla Glass 3

• Rear camera: 13 MP and 4k video capture at 30 fps

• Front camera: 2MP and HD video conferencing

• Ports: Single micro-USB 2.0 for USB data/charging 3.5mm audio jack Nano SIM

• CPU: 2.7 GHz Qualcomm Snapdragon 805 with quad-core CPU

• Memory: 3GB RAM

• Battery**: 3220 mAh Talk time up to 24 hours Video playback up to 10 hours Internet use time (LTE) up to 10 hours Internet use time (Wi-Fi) up to 9.5 hours

• Wireless: 802.11 ac 2x2 (MIMO) Bluetooth 4.1 NFC

• Sensors: GPS, Accelerometer, Gyroscope, Magnetometer, Ambient light sensor, Barometer

**Testing was conducted by Google using pre-production Nexus 6 devices and software. Talk time tests used default settings with Wi-Fi off and LTE on. Standby time tests used default settings with LTE on and Wi-Fi on. Wi-Fi internet tests had Airplane Mode on with Wi-Fi connected to a test access point, while loading three popular websites cached on a local server. The Nexus 6 loaded a page, waited 40 seconds, and then loaded a page from the next site. LTE internet tests had Wi-Fi off and LTE on, and used the same testing method as the Wi-Fi internet tests.
